HOW HEAVY IS A TERRASTAIR?

This is dependent on the length and gradient of your slope. We manufacture Terrastair in sections however and ensure that each section if lift able without mechanical equipment. Each section typically is less that 3M long.

HOW DO I MEASURE MY SLOPE?

Each tread on a stair is required to be uniform in size to all others within a flight of treads. Terrastair therefore works on a regular slope, i.e. a straight slope as shown. All that is required is the length along the surface of the slope and the gradient. We will design a Terrastair to fit your slope and email you the design back for approval.

CAN I USE TERRASTAIR ON DIFFERENT SLOPES?

Yes – if the gradient is the same then the treads will be horizontal. There would be no problem in using sections on a different slope. If the gradient is different, then the treads will not be horizontal. We would not recommend that terrastair be used where the treads were not horizontal.
